Abstract
Historiography, in the last four decades, has changed the way space is included in history as a category for analysis. Multiple scales, connections and space-temporal dynamics have emerged in the discipline that has led to questioning the Nation-state as the dominant spatiality of society. Based on the notion of regime of historicity, this article states that this change in the discipline is related to a turn in society which tends to privilege present over future in the conception and experience of time, which is, in turn, related to a critique of progress as the driving concept of society.
